Mastering Data Transformation with Python and Pandas: Real-World Applications and Case Studies

June 05, 2026 3 min read Madison Lewis

Learn data transformation with Python and Pandas through real-world case studies in social media and retail analytics.

In today's data-driven world, the ability to transform and manipulate data is a critical skill for any data analyst or scientist. The Advanced Certificate in Hands-On Data Transformation with Python and Pandas is a comprehensive course designed to equip you with the tools and knowledge needed to handle real-world data challenges effectively. This blog post will delve into the practical applications and real-world case studies that highlight the power and versatility of Python and Pandas in data transformation.

Understanding the Basics of Data Transformation

Before we dive into the real-world applications, let's quickly review what data transformation entails. Data transformation involves converting raw data into a format that is more suitable for analysis. This process can include cleaning data, merging datasets, reshaping data, and more. Python, with its powerful data manipulation library, Pandas, is an excellent tool for handling these tasks efficiently.

# Key Concepts in Data Transformation

- Data Cleaning: Removing or correcting incomplete, incorrect, or irrelevant parts of the data.

- Data Merging: Combining multiple datasets into a single dataset.

- Data Reshaping: Changing the structure of the data, such as converting wide data to long data or vice versa.

- Data Aggregation: Summarizing data by applying functions like sum, mean, etc., to specific groups within the dataset.

Practical Applications of Data Transformation with Python and Pandas

# Case Study 1: Social Media Analytics

Imagine you are working for a social media company that wants to analyze user engagement on different platforms. You have data from Twitter, Instagram, and Facebook, each in its own format. Using Python and Pandas, you can:

1. Clean the Data: Remove duplicates, fix inconsistencies, and handle missing values.

2. Merge Datasets: Combine the data from all platforms into a single dataset.

3. Reshape the Data: Convert the data to a long format to analyze user engagement over time.

4. Aggregation: Calculate metrics like total likes, shares, and comments per user.

This example showcases how Python and Pandas can streamline the process of integrating and analyzing data from multiple sources, providing valuable insights into user behavior.

# Case Study 2: Retail Sales Analysis

A retail company wants to understand their sales trends and customer preferences. They have sales data, customer demographics, and product information. Using Python and Pandas, you can:

1. Clean the Data: Handle missing sales figures and incorrect customer information.

2. Merge Datasets: Integrate sales data with customer and product information.

3. Reshape the Data: Convert the data to a long format to analyze customer preferences.

4. Aggregation: Calculate total sales by product category and customer segment.

These steps help the company identify which products are most popular among different customer groups, enabling better inventory management and targeted marketing strategies.

Conclusion

The Advanced Certificate in Hands-On Data Transformation with Python and Pandas is not just a course; it's a gateway to mastering the art of data manipulation. Through practical applications and real-world case studies, you'll learn how to transform raw data into actionable insights. Whether you're analyzing social media engagement or retail sales data, Python and Pandas will empower you to handle complex data challenges with ease.

By the end of this course, you'll be well-equipped to take on any data transformation project, whether it's for a small business or a large corporation. Don't miss the opportunity to elevate your data analysis skills and open up new career paths in the field of data science. Enroll in the course today and start transforming your data into gold!

Ready to Transform Your Career?

Take the next step in your professional journey with our comprehensive course designed for business leaders

Disclaimer

The views and opinions expressed in this blog are those of the individual authors and do not necessarily reflect the official policy or position of LSBR School of Professional Development. The content is created for educational purposes by professionals and students as part of their continuous learning journey. LSBR School of Professional Development does not guarantee the accuracy, completeness, or reliability of the information presented. Any action you take based on the information in this blog is strictly at your own risk. LSBR School of Professional Development and its affiliates will not be liable for any losses or damages in connection with the use of this blog content.

8,303 views
Back to Blog

This course help you to:

  • Boost your Salary
  • Increase your Professional Reputation, and
  • Expand your Networking Opportunities

Ready to take the next step?

Enrol now in the

Advanced Certificate in Hands-On Data Transformation with Python and Pandas

Enrol Now